12     Sec. 125.  EFFECTIVE DATES.
13     1.  Sections 100, 101, 102, 103, and 104 of this
14   division of this Act take effect July 1, 1996.
15     2.  Sections 105, 106, 107, 114, and 116 take
16   effect January 1, 1996, and are applicable to taxes
17   paid in the fiscal year beginning July 1, 1996, and
18   succeeding fiscal years.
19     3.  The remainder of this division of this Act,
20   being deemed of immediate importance, takes effect
21   upon enactment."

Bernau of Story offered the following amendment H-3204, to the
committee amendment H-3030, previously deferred, filed by
Bernau, et. al., and moved its adoption:
H-3204
 1     Amend the amendment, H-3030, to Senate File 69, as
 2   passed by the Senate as follows:
 3     1.  By striking page 13, line 41, through page 16,
 4   line 43.
 5     2.  Page 16, by inserting after line 45 the
 6   following:
 7     "Sec. 131.  Section 425.40, Code 1995, is amended
 8   by striking the section and inserting the following:
 9     425.40  LOW-INCOME FUND CREATED.
10     The low-income tax credit and reimbursement fund is
11   created.  There is appropriated annually from the
12   general fund of the state to the department of revenue
13   and finance to be credited to the low-income tax
14   credit and reimbursement fund, from funds not
15   otherwise appropriated, an amount sufficient to
16   implement this division."
